Output 53313f2f2bdfd2b3e31a50a1e4f697e73cd05ecbe721d0f160c665a5a698c968:0

value
37284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28c5159b2c7d49f3132c7552e721362ec03af9b2 OP_EQUAL
address
35Qb3t4Cy6jEuLUbF1uPVFbDfSD58hMxYq
transaction
53313f2f2bdfd2b3e31a50a1e4f697e73cd05ecbe721d0f160c665a5a698c968
confirmations
127849
spent
true